  • lefty
    replied
    Originally posted by dark.magnet View Post
    Let's say for example someone wants to buy the DSSD.

    Retail is 15.7k? So it would qualify for the maximum $1000 rebate.
    But if dealer can give 10% off (obviously more than the 1k rebate), i don't think the 1k rebate would apply.
    And vice versa, if buyer takes advantage of the 1k rebate, don't think the dealer can give additional 10% off.

    I guess this deal is for those who don't have a regular dealer to go to?
    Rebate given is based on the final price after whatever negotiations you have on the watch. 5% rebate is given based on the final bill.

    So if retail on any given watch is for eg $20k and you manage to haggle for a 10% discount = $18k

    You sign $18k on the VISA slip

    You will ultimately still get 5% rebate back based on $18k = $900

    Originally posted by lefty View Post
    $1000 or 5% of net selling price whichever is lower.

    A $20,000 watch will get you the max $1000 rebate, which makes it better then Cortina's 13% via ANZ which is capped at $780max

    However, a $6000 watch will get you $300 rebate, which is lower then Cortina's 13% which will give you $780
